WebOct 4, 2024 · For most SSRI’s, except fluoxetine, this equates to about 5 days. Start the 2nd antidepressant at starting dose recommendations. Risk of drug interactions is low here, but the switch can take longer. Moderate switch: Gradually reduce and stop the 1st antidepressant, then start a washout period of 2 days. The main difference between SSRIs and SNRIs is that SSRIs prevent the reuptake of serotonin and SNRIs prevent the reuptake of serotonin and norepinephrine. Serotonin and norepinephrine are substances that the brain uses to send messages from one nerve cell to another. They are also called neurotransmitters.
